Microchip Technology's ATMEGA1281V-8MUR Microcontroller
The ATMEGA1281V-8MUR is a high-performance, low-power AVR 8-bit microcontroller from the industry-leading manufacturer Microchip Technology. Key Features
- Advanced RISC Architecture: The ATMEGA1281V-8MUR operates with a powerful Advanced RISC (Reduced Instruction Set Computing) architecture, enabling fast and efficient processing with a throughput of 1 MIPS (Million Instructions Per Second) per MHz.
- High Memory Capacity: It comes equipped with 128KB of in-system programmable flash, 8KB RAM, and 4KB of EEPROM, providing ample space for complex applications and data storage.
- Speed and Power Efficiency: This microcontroller operates at a clock speed of 8MHz and is optimized for low voltage operation, ranging from 1.8V to 5.5V, making it suitable for battery-powered and portable devices.
- Robust Peripheral Set: The device includes a variety of peripherals such as timers, counters, a 10-bit ADC (Analog-to-Digital Converter) with 16 channels, an analog comparator, PWM channels, and serial communication modules (USART, SPI, and TWI).
- Programmability and Debugging: The ATMEGA1281V-8MUR supports JTAG (Joint Test Action Group) and SPI programming, allowing for easy implementation and debugging of applications.
- Temperature Range: This microcontroller is designed to operate within an industrial temperature range of -40°C to 85°C, ensuring reliability under extreme conditions.
